Description of key information

Tests with structural analogues are available. In the test with diisopropylbenzene hydroperoxide no mortality was observed up to 0.87 mg/L (Hüls 1993). At higher concentrations ca. 100% of the fish died. The LC50 was calculated to be 1.7 mg/L (measured concentrations were 76.4-112% of nominal).

Additional information

The test in zebrafish with diisopropylbenzene hydroperoxide is considered most appropriate for read-across as in this test the concentrations are analysed. The rationale for the read-across is documented in chapter 13.
